Uploaded image for project: 'OpenShift Bugs'
  1. OpenShift Bugs
  2. OCPBUGS-4894

Disabled Serverless add actions should not be displayed for Knative Service

    XMLWordPrintable

Details

    • Low
    • Rejected
    • False
    • Hide

      None

      Show
      None
    • NA

    Description

      Description of problem:
      This is a follow-up on OCPBUGS-2579, where Prabhu fixed a similar issue for catalog items "Helm Charts" and "Samples" and a follow-up on OCPBUGS-4012 where Jai fied this for Serverless actions "Event Sink", "Event Source", "Channel" and "Broken".

      But one "Event source" leftover is still shown when drag and drop the arrow from a Knative Service.

      Version-Release number of selected component (if applicable):
      4.13, earlier versions have the same issue

      How reproducible:
      Always

      Steps to Reproduce:
      1. Install Serverless operator and create Eventing and Serving resources
      2. Import an application (Developer perspective > add > container image) and create a Knative Service
      3. Open customization (path /cluster-configuration/) and disable all add actions
      4. Wait some seconds and check that the Developer perspective > Add page shows no items
      5. Navigate to topology perspective and drag and drop the arrow from a Knative Service to an empty area.

      Actual results:
      "Event Source" is shown

      Expected results:
      "Event Source" should not be shown

      Additional info:
      Follow up on OCPBUGS-2579 and OCPBUGS-4012

      Attachments

        Issue Links

          Activity

            People

              rh-ee-lprabhu Lokananda Prabhu
              cjerolim Christoph Jerolimov
              Sanket Pathak Sanket Pathak
              Red Hat Employee
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: